Navicat Data Modeler Ess 是一款直观且强大的数据库设计工具,专为 macOS 用户打造。它支持多种主流数据库系统,例如 MySQL、MariaDB、Oracle、SQL Server、PostgreSQL 和 SQLite。用户可以轻松创建和管理数据模型,通过专业的对象设计器进行表和视图的创建和修改,不需要编写复杂的 SQL 代码。使用简单友好的绘图工具,仅需几次点击即可完成完整的数据模型构建。

3d9fe80bd67806e603bee5f429d20d75

支持构建高级的概念、逻辑和物理数据模型,可以通过模型转换功能,将业务级的概念模型转换为分析级的关系数据库模型,再转换为物理数据库实现。反向工程功能允许用户加载现有的数据库结构,创建新数据模型和 ER 图,以可视化的方式展示数据库模型,便于查看属性、关系、索引等对象的关系,增强数据库设计的直观性和可操作性。

同时具备强大的比较和同步功能,比较数据库差异并生成同步脚本,确保数据库与模型一致。还支持导出 SQL 脚本,为模型的各个部分生成独立的 SQL 代码,显著提升工作效率。标准设计工具包括层次、图像、形状、标签等,让用户以灵活多样的方式管理数据模型。Navicat Data Modeler Ess 为数据库设计和开发提供了全面且易用的解决方案。

macOS 版 Navicat Data Modeler Ess 的功能

  • 数据库对象:使用适用于表和视图的专业对象设计器创建、修改和设计模型。您将准确地知道自己正在做什么,而无需编写复杂的 SQL 来创建和编辑对象。此外,它还支持三种标准符号:Crow's Foot、IDEF1x 和 UML。使用我们功能丰富、简单且用户友好的绘图工具,您只需单击几下即可开发完整的数据模型。
  • 模型类型:它使您能够为各种受众构建高质量的概念、逻辑和物理数据模型。使用模型转换功能,您可以将概念业务级模型转换为分析关系数据库模型,然后转换为物理数据库实现,从勾勒出系统设计的总体轮廓到查看关系以及使用链接实体、表和视图中的属性和列。您可以快速部署对数据库结构的准确更改,并构建有组织且更有效的数据库系统。
  • 逆向工程:加载现有数据库结构并创建新的 ER 图。可视化数据库模型以查看属性、关系、索引、唯一值、注释和其他对象如何关联,而无需显示实际数据。它支持不同的数据库:直接连接、ODBC、MySQL、MariaDB、Oracle、SQL Server、PostgreSQL 和 SQLite。
  • 比较和同步:同步到数据库功能将为您提供所有数据库差异的完整信息。比较数据库后,您可以查看差异并生成同步脚本来更新目标数据库,使其与您的模型相同。灵活的设置使您能够设置用于比较和同步的自定义键。
  • SQL 代码生成:它不仅仅是一个创建 ER 图和设计数据库的工具。其导出 SQL 功能让您可以完全控制最终的 SQL 脚本。它允许您生成模型的各个部分、引用完整性规则、注释、字符集等,从而可能为您节省数百小时的工作时间。
  • 标准设计工具:添加顶点、图层、图像、形状、注释/标签、对齐/分布对象、无限撤消/重做容量、自动布局、搜索过滤器等。

技术细节和系统要求

MacOS 10.14 或更高版本

声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。